Detailed description:
The Sarajevo Wastewater project aims at improving the water quality of Miljacka and Bosna rivers by rehabilitating the idle wastewater treatment plant at Butila and improving the efficiency of the sewer systems in the Sarajevo Canton. These measures will reduce the exposure of downstream communities to polluted surface water and improve the environmental conditions.
The existing WWTP, which was constructed in 1984, will be rehabilitated and upgraded in 2 phases:
Phase 1: Rehabilitation of the existing WWTP to re-establish the original capacity and treatment level (secondary treatment), 600.000 PE
Phase 2: Upgrade of the WWTP for nutrient removal to achieve compliance with EU standard, 650.000 PE

Design flows:
Parameters | Unit of measure | Phase I | Phase II |
Raw water pumping station/ preliminary treatment | m3/s | 5.2 | 5.2 |
The Primary sedimentation | m3/s | 2.6 (4.4) | 4.4 |
Biological Treatment | m3/s | 2.6 | 4.4 |
Design Mass Loadings for WWTP :
Parameters | Unit of measure | Phase I | Phase II |
Biological Oxygen Demand | kgBOD5/d | 36’000 | 39’000 |
Chemical Oxygen Demand | kgCOD/d | 72’000 | 78’000 |
Total Suspended Solids | kgTSS/d | 42’000 | 45’500 |
Total Kjeldahl Nitrogen | kgTKN/d | 6’600 | 7’150 |
Total Phosphorus | kgPtot/d | 1’080 | 1’170 |
Basic elements of the plant:
- Pretreatment
- Biological treatment (primary sedimentation tanks, aeration, secondary sedimentation tanks, sludge recirculation)
- Sludge treatment sludge with recuperation of energy
